课程概览

文本对比与 Diff 课程

系统学习实用文本对比流程:行级/词级 diff、并排与 unified 视图、配置与日志排查,以及何时用文本 diff 而非 JSON diff。

本课程讲解 文本 diff 作为开发者日常评审技能 的实际用法。对比两段文本不只是 Git 的功能。开发者每天都会比较环境配置、部署清单、日志片段、curl 响应、复制的 API 载荷和手工修改。

你将学习何时行级 diff 足够、何时需要词级高亮、并排与 unified 视图的区别,以及如何避免被空白或大小写噪声误导。

适合谁

  • 需要对比 staging 与 production 配置的开发者
  • 需要评审 API 响应变化的后端与全栈工程师
  • 需要检查 env 文件和部署片段的 DevOps / 平台工程师
  • 需要快速本地 diff、又不想打开整个仓库的人

你将学到

  1. 什么是文本 diff,以及它在日常工作中的位置
  2. 并排对比与 unified diff 视图
  3. 词级高亮与变更统计
  4. 配置与环境变量文件对比流程
  5. 日志与 API 响应对比流程
  6. 实用调试流程,包括文本 diff 与 JSON diff 的选择

阅读时可以配合 文本对比 / Diff 检查器 练习。目标不只是看到颜色高亮,而是为当前任务选择正确的对比模式。